Azhakotha Mahadeva Temple History and Significance

Believed to have been established by Sage Parashurama, Azhakotha Mahadeva Temple is an architectural masterpiece that uniquely combines the spiritual essence of both Vishnu and Shiva. Historically, the temple was under the jurisdiction of the Palakkad kings and managed by the Paniyyormanakkal Namboothiris. Due to conflicts, the Namboothiris relocated to Malappuram with the assistance of the Kozhikode rulers (Zamorin). In response, the Palakkad king invited Brahmin families from Thanjavur, Tamil Nadu, establishing 51 Agraharams around the temple. The temple suffered destruction during Tipu Sultan's invasions but was later reconstructed under the patronage of the Kozhikode Zamorin. Notably, the temple's Bhagavathy deity is worshipped in the form of Goddess Saraswathi.

Azhakotha Mahadeva Temple Pooja Timing

Pooja Name Timings
Nirmalyam 5:00 AM to 5:15 AM IST
Usha Pooja 6:00 AM to 6:30 AM IST
Ucha Pooja 10:30 AM to 11:00 AM IST
Athazha Pooja 7:00 PM to 7:30 PM IST

Temple info
Temple info:
Azhakotha Mahadeva Temple, located in Kuzhalmannam, Kerala, is a revered Hindu shrine dedicated to Lord Shiva and Baalaraman. The temple is renowned for its monolithic Shiva idol, intricately carved from a single rock and standing over six feet tall. With a history spanning over 2,500 years, the temple's circular Sree Kovil (sanctum sanctorum) exemplifies traditional Kerala architecture.
